Frequent DLL Difficulties

Frequent DLL Difficulties

The DLL (Dynamic-backlink library) is Microsoft's execution of a "joint archives" notion inside of OS/2 operating methods and Microsoft Windows. These modules ordinarily use the file extensions DLL, DRV (for LegacySystem drivers, and OCX (for information containing ActiveX controls).

DLL file formats and MS Home windows-centered EXEs are related. The Moveable Executable (PE) for Windows 32 and sixty four-little bit and the New Executable (NE) for Windows 16-little bit present these similarities. Both equally DLLs and EXEs include assets, codes, and information in several combos.

Quite a few DLL issues can take place simply because of different reasons. Missing registry entries, corrupt DLLs, misplaced DLL data files, and copy DLLs are the most common results in of these DLL-relevant concerns. One more frequent bring about of DLL issues is the existence of an incorrect DLL edition in the method.  vcruntime140 dll missing  can be corrected by installing many versions of the DLL. Below are specific aspects about the most widespread will cause of DLL issues:

Lacking DLLs - This only usually means the DLL can not be observed anywhere on the method. This can be settled by configuring the latest location of the DLLs on the software. A missing DLL is also prompted by an application calling a DLL with a diverse filename. This indicates the software simply cannot uncover the DLL it requirements because the module mounted on the equipment comes with a various filename.

Corrupt DLLs - a DLL can be corrupted for many explanations. Virus and adware bacterial infections are the main will cause of DLL corruption. Whilst some bacterial infections depart these DLLs unusable by the OS or any software, some change the info within the modules. This triggers the programs that require the DLLs to behave abnormally immediately after contacting the altered DLL with the correct filename and spot. This can also result to technique freezes, slowdowns, or crashes.

Incorrect DLL Versions - numerous glitches can consequence from incorrect DLL versions installed on the procedure. Purposes perform much better when making use of the hottest variations of the DLLs it wants. This is why it is significant to put in the most up-to-date DLL versions on your technique. Also, purposes that use more mature versions of a DLL will not encounter problems even when the newest version of the DLL is discovered on the program. This is for the reason that DLLs are embedded with backwards compatibility, which signifies the similar aged simply call functions and protocols discovered on outdated versions of the DLL are also obtainable on its most recent variations.